CARD FRAUD ANALYST AT DUPLO- LAGOS

Lagos, Nigeria | Posted on 13/01/2026

About Company:

Duplo is building the platform to power the next generation of financial services. Our mission is to help companies expand financial access for all. Our simple and powerful banking-as-a-service API helps companies quickly launch financial products.

We are recruiting to fill the position below:

Job Description:

  • We’re looking for a Card Fraud Analyst (Acquiring) to join our team, with a strong focus on acquiring-side card fraud, merchant chargebacks, and investigations within our Atlas product.
  • This role sits at the intersection of fraud prevention, analytics, and product collaboration, helping to reduce fraud losses while maintaining a strong customer experience.

Key Responsibilities:
Card Fraud Prevention & Risk Management:

  • Safeguard customers against unauthorised card activity, scams, and payment instrument or account takeover fraud.
  • Analyse card fraud disputes and emerging trends to identify weaknesses or opportunities within existing fraud prevention rules
  • Review and enhance fraud controls across authorisation, post-authorisation, and tokenisation flows
  • Incorporate card scheme indicators and internal machine learning signals into static fraud rules to improve accuracy and effectivenes
  • Contribute to longer-term initiatives aimed at reducing card fraud and improving overall risk posture.
  • Partner closely with Product and Engineering teams to evolve the rule engine and improve the end-to-end fraud customer journey, from declines and alerts through to dispute submission.
  • Act as an escalation point for card fraud prevention topics for customer-facing Operations teams

Analytical & Strategic Capabilities:

  • Independently manage and prioritise competing workflows, including team initiatives and external escalations, delivering high-quality outcomes within agreed timelines.
  • Assess and articulate the impact of fraud rules on customer spend, approval rates, and user experience
  • Produce clear, high-quality analysis that directly addresses business and risk problems.
  • Navigate complex problem spaces and understand the trade-offs involved in fraud decision-making
  • Proactively propose and develop strategies to mitigate emerging fraud patterns or large-scale fraud events
  • Write, test, and maintain analytical code independently and collaboratively, ensuring it is readable, reusable, and well-documente
  • Test and validate fraud rule logic autonomously, and troubleshoot issues related to code, data, or risk engine behaviour.
  • Continuously learn and apply new analytical tools, techniques, and methodologies.

Communication & Collaboration:

  • Clearly explain analyses, decisions, and recommendations to teammates and immediate stakeholders.
  • Present fraud trends, insights, and learnings in a concise and structured manner
  • Support and collaborate with peers, sharing knowledge and best practices where needed.

Incident & Risk Management:

  • Provide timely data, insights, and analysis to support fraud incidents and investigations.
  • Escalate risks that fall outside the Card Fraud remit or risk appetite to relevant internal or external stakeholders.

Requirements:

  • 4–5 years of experience in fraud prevention, risk management, or payments risk, with a strong focus on card fraud.
  • Solid understanding of card payment flows, including authorisation, post-authorisation, chargebacks e.t.c
  • Detailed understanding of the operational aspects of payment cards, mobile payments, the fintech and banking industry.
  • Strong problem-solving skills, with the ability to work independently in ambiguous or fast-paced environments.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Solid understanding of payment gateways, acquiring banks, and merchant processors, including knowledge of network-specific chargeback procedures (Visa, Mastercard, etc.).
